Post subject:  Lord Owen condemns “conspiracy of silence” on trade deal

Quote:
Sources close to the mandate negotiations say that unlike the CETA (the Canadian EU trade negotiations) that there is at present no plan to exclude arrangements for health care and protection and in particular for the NHS in its different forms in England, Scotland, Wales and Northern Ireland.

Because of the intense secrecy surrounding the proceedings it has been so far impossible to obtain any assurances on this crucial issue. The British press so far only cover the trade aspects.

http://www.opendemocracy.net/ournhs/dav ... -condemns-“conspiracy-of-silence”-on-eu-us-trade-deal

Quote:
Such [investment protection extended to private health contracts in the UK] could have the effect of health contracts being virtually retained in perpetuity with no democratic right for an incoming government to discontinue the contracts once their term had expired without being able to prove gross negligence and risking very heavy compensation payments. Ominously, the Prime Minister suggested that “everything must be on the table” in the negotiations.


Quote:
It is why I have today presented a short Bill for the reinstatement of the English NHS.

Looks like Lord Owen is concerned that the NHS is being dismantled and sold off the US health companies with pretty much permanent contracts. Technically, we have no NHS right now - the Secretary of State was relieved of his duty to provide it in the Act passed earlier this year.
